#e78f9e basic color information

#e78f9e

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#e78f9e has decimal index of: 15175582, is composed of 90.6% red, 56.1% green and 62% blue. #e78f9e in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 38.1% magenta, 31.6% yellow and 9.4% black.
#ff9999 is the closest web-safe color to #e78f9e.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
